CCIT
CCIT Logo

C++ Programming 

  • Offered byCCIT

C++ Programming
 at 
CCIT 
Overview

This Course is designed for software programmers who need to learn C++ Programming

Duration

114 hours

Mode of learning

Online

Credential

Certificate

C++ Programming
Table of content
Accordion Icon V3
  • Overview
  • Highlights
  • Course Details
  • Curriculum
  • Student Reviews

C++ Programming
 at 
CCIT 
Highlights

  • Earn a certificate after successful completion of the program
Details Icon

C++ Programming
 at 
CCIT 
Course details

Skills you will learn
More about this course
  • This training program help professionals to acquire skills in cutting-edge technologies that are being deployed in todays organizations and get an edge over their colleagues

C++ Programming
 at 
CCIT 
Curriculum

Introduction

Concepts of Object Oriented Programming

Benefits of OOP

What is C++

Structure of C++ Program

Creating the Source File

Compiling and Linking

Variables, and Data Types

Tokens, Keywords & Identifiers

Data Types

Type Compatibility

Variable Declaration

Dynamic Initialization of Variables

Functions in C++

Function Prototyping

Call by Reference

Return by Reference

Inline Functions

Default Arguments

Recursion

Function Overloading

Friend and Virtual Functions

Operators & Expressions

Operators in C++

Scope Resolution Operator

Member Dereferencing Operators

Memory Management Operators

Manipulators

Type Cast Operator

Expressions and Types of Expressions

Special Assignment Expressions

Implicit Conversions

Operator Overloading

Operator Precedence

Control Structures

Classes and Objects

Specifying a Class

Defining Member Functions

Making an Outside Function Inline

Nesting of Member Functions

Private Member Functions

Arrays within a Class

Memory Allocation for Objects

Static Data Members

Static Member Functions

Arrays of Objects

Objects as Function Arguments

Friendly Functions

Returning Objects

Constructors and Destructors

Constructors

Parameterized Constructors

Multiple Constructors in a Class

Constructors with Default Arguments

Dynamic Initialization of Objects

Copy Constructor

Dynamic Constructors

Destructors

Inheritance

Defining Derived Classes

Single Inheritance

Types of Inheritance

Virtual Base Classes

Abstract Classes

Constructors in Derived Classes

Member Classes

Operator Overloading

Defining Operator Overloading

Overloading Unary Operators

Overloading Binary Operators

Overloading Binary Operators using Friends

Manipulation of Strings using Operators

Rules of Operator Overloading

Type Conversion

C++ Programming
 at 
CCIT 
Students Ratings & Reviews

5/5
Verified Icon1 Rating
R
Renuka khopale
C++ Programming
Offered by CCIT
5
Learning Experience: Easy content platform was very good to train the programing skill is well good
Faculty: Lectures was very easy to learn and get a practical knowledge as much as possible Assignment was really good it's take MCQ question
Course Support: No career support provided
Reviewed on 19 Jun 2022Read More
Thumbs Up IconThumbs Down Icon
View 1 ReviewRight Arrow Icon
qna

C++ Programming
 at 
CCIT 

Student Forum

chatAnything you would want to ask experts?
Write here...